Role Overview
This position leads commercial growth for a payment and software solutions provider by owning the entire revenue lifecycle—from sourcing and closing new business to ensuring newly signed merchants become active, transacting, and retained. The manager also guides a team of Business Development Executives, sets the pace for pipeline discipline, and works cross-functionally to keep onboarding compliant and efficient. The role is central to the company’s expansion strategy in the fintech ecosystem across banks, SACCOs, remittance firms, corporates, and fellow fintechs.
Key Responsibilities
- Shape and execute the annual business development plan, aligning it with company revenue goals, product priorities, and market-entry targets.
- Take direct ownership of monthly and quarterly revenue numbers for an assigned portfolio of products, regions, and key accounts.
- Proactively source new opportunities through outbound outreach, industry events, referrals, partner introductions, and targeted market research—not just inbound leads.
- Cultivate and manage senior-level relationships with merchants, banks, SACCOs, remittance operators, and fintech partners, positioning the company as a preferred payment technology partner.
- Run the full sales cycle: qualify prospects, build proposals, negotiate commercial terms, draft contracts, and coordinate a smooth handoff to onboarding and technical teams.
- Identify and negotiate strategic partnerships that unlock new revenue streams, transaction volumes, or distribution channels.
- Drive merchant success after go-live by pushing activation rates, supporting transaction growth, addressing churn risk, and running reactivation campaigns for dormant accounts.
- Keep a clean, realistic sales pipeline in the CRM, logging every activity, stage change, and forecast update so leadership has accurate visibility.
- Collaborate with Operations, Compliance, Finance, and Engineering to prevent onboarding bottlenecks and ensure every merchant is implemented in line with regulatory and internal policy.
- Coach and mentor Business Development Executives, helping them improve pitch quality, negotiation skills, and pipeline hygiene while supporting their individual target achievement.
- Review sales and merchant performance data weekly, diagnose shortfalls, and implement corrective actions before targets slip.
- Deliver routine reporting on pipeline health, closed revenue, activation metrics, and emerging risks, along with recommended responses.
Requirements &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Business, Marketing, Finance, Economics, or a comparable discipline.
- At least five years of hands-on experience in business development, sales, or strategic partnerships, with a proven record of meeting or beating revenue targets.
- Prior experience in fintech, payments, banking, financial services, SaaS, or adjacent technology sectors—ideally with direct involvement in merchant acquisition.
- A strong, active professional network across banking, payments, remittances, SACCOs, telecom, or corporate sectors that can be leveraged immediately for referrals and warm introductions.
- Solid grasp of payment products, card acquiring, digital wallets, remittance flows, and the operational realities of merchant onboarding.
- Demonstrated ability to lead and develop junior sales staff, including coaching on negotiation, pipeline management, and client communication.
- Excellent presentation and negotiation skills, with the confidence to engage C-level executives and close complex, multi-stakeholder deals.
- Proficiency with CRM systems and sales analytics tools, using data to forecast and prioritise.
- A hunter mindset: comfortable with outbound activity, resilient in the face of rejection, and methodical in following up until a deal is won or lost.
